Evidently inspired by Pavement's landmark Crooked Rain, Crooked Rain and Archers of Loaf's Icky Mettle, Portland's Minmae concocts bold, capable indie rock that's as long on guitar power ("Experimental Pop Song) as it is on inventive arrangements. Okay, in the face of the aforementioned -- not to mention Smog -- countrified stompers ("Dimorphic Hips Have Chances Still") and winsome, pedal steel-augmented weepers ("My Parts Will Not Rust") are hardly revolutionary. Still, with a decade-plus of depth, very little in the indie rock world straddles melody and six-string mayhem with the type of finesse exhibited on 2005's I'd Be Scared, Were You Still Burning. To put it simply, Minmae makes gold soundz for now people. ~ John D. Luerssen
Personnel: Josh Kempa (electric bass, background vocals); Christopher Calvert (drums, background vocals); Greg Murphy (drums).

$26.79 L'ECHO was nominated for Best Traditional Folk Album in the 37th Annual Grammy Awards.
L'ECHO delivers what Beausoleil fans have come to expect--spicy, vigorous music steeped deeply in the traditions of the Louisiana bayou country. Though the band's long discography features frequent modernizations of the Cajun and zydeco styles, L'ECHO finds it returning, once again, to its roots. As group founder, vocalist, and master fiddler Michael Doucet claims in the liner notes, the album is meant as a tribute to some of Louisiana's forgotten musical leaders, including the Alley Boys ("Chere Petite Blond"), The Hackberry Ramblers ("Cajun Crawl") and the Breaux Freres ("Hip Et Ti-Yeaux).
